NVIDIA Build is a cloud platform that gives developers access to NVIDIA's AI infrastructure, pre-trained models, and development tools for building, testing, and deploying AI applications without requiring on-premise GPU hardware.
The platform provides API access to optimized AI models across a range of domains including language, vision, speech, and biology, alongside NVIDIA's NIM (NVIDIA Inference Microservices) for deploying custom models with enterprise-grade performance and reliability.
The platform is designed to accelerate the AI development lifecycle: developers can access foundation models for rapid prototyping, use NVIDIA's optimization tools to improve model performance for their specific use case, and deploy production-ready inference endpoints that take advantage of NVIDIA's GPU architecture for industry-leading throughput and latency.
Integration with major cloud providers and on-premise deployment options provide flexibility for different deployment requirements.
NVIDIA Build is positioned for enterprises and developers building serious AI applications where performance, reliability, and access to state-of-the-art model capabilities matter particularly for teams that want to leverage NVIDIA's deep expertise in AI infrastructure without managing the underlying hardware complexity.
Its combination of model access, optimization tooling, and deployment infrastructure makes it a comprehensive platform for organizations where AI capability is a core part of their product or competitive advantage.
